Malawi human right activist Mtambo leaves HRDC to near politics

LILONGWE-(MaraviPost)-The country’s Human Rights Defenders’ Coalition (HRDC) outgoing Chairperson, Timothy Mtambo on Wednesday announced leaving HDRC, a civil society organization to start a revolution that will fight for the rights of Malawians through nomination of political leadership.

Speaking at pressing briefing in Lilongwe, Mtambo said has made the decision after making thorough consultations with both local and international civil society leaders

Mtambo, who addressed the media alone; without other HRDC leaders, said HRDC has registered a number of success stories but his main agendum is to change the current political leadership of Democratic Progressive Party (DPP), so that Malawi Congress Party (MCP) and UTM Alliance can take over.

Mtambo, who has launched a movement known as Citizen For Transformation (CFT) has called upon all Malawians to join the same and fight a political change in Malawi.

He has declared that he will be the Commander-In-Chief of the movement.

Mambo, who quoted former US President, Abraham Lincoln; who once said: “You can delay change but you can’t stop it, has also said that it is time for every Malawians to demand change from the current political leadership or any other leadership in the future”.

While imploring the youths in the country to join hands, Mtambo has therefore endorsed the MCP-UTM Alliance as the only political leadership that will transform the country.
